Korea Foundation Associate Professor/Professor of Korean Studies in the Social Sciences
The Faculty of Arts and Sciences at Columbia University in the City of New York invites applications for the Korea Foundation Professor of Korean Studies in the Social Sciences. We seek a scholar who covers Modern Korean History to be appointed at the rank of professor or associate professor with tenure. The successful candidate will be appointed in the Department of History, working closely with the Department of East Asian Languages and Cultures. Beyond teaching undergraduate and graduate courses in Modern Korean History, the incumbent will be expected to participate in the activities of the Weatherhead East Asian Institute (WEAI) as well as play a leadership role at the Center for Korean Research, which is a research center within WEAI.
